Business Structure in Yonkers

If you are opening a business in Yonkers, you can choose among various available business structures and you will want to know about them all. The options include a Sole Proprietorship, Partnership, Corporation or LLC. Each of these business structures has its own advantages and disadvantages in Yonkers, and determining which structure is right for your business can be challenging.
